The Lopez-Negrete surname is a combination of two distinct surnames - Lopez and Negrete. Both of these surnames have Spanish origins and are commonly found in Spain and other Spanish-speaking countries. The surname Lopez is derived from the given name Lope, which is of Basque origin. The name Lope itself means "wolf," symbolizing strength, courage, and independence. The Negrete surname, on the other hand, has roots in the town of Negrete in the Asturias region of Spain.
